libcapnp-1.1.0

Cap'n Proto C++ library

Similar to Protocol Buffers, Cap'n Proto is an efficient means of serializing structured data to be transferred across a network or written to disk. Users write a Cap'n Proto definition file that drives a code generator, which in turn emits C++ code for encoding & decoding messages in the Cap'n Proto format.

coinor-ipopt

Interior-Point Optimizer - AMPL solver executables

Ipopt is an open-source solver for large-scale nonlinear continuous optimization. It can be used from modeling environments, such as AMPL, GAMS, or Matlab, and it is also available as a callable library with interfaces to C++, C, and Fortran. Ipopt uses an interior point method, together with a filter linear search procedure. Ipopt is part of the larger COIN-OR initiative (Computational Infrastructure for Operations Research).

gnat-14-arm-linux-gnueabihf

GNU Ada compiler for the arm-linux-gnueabihf architecture

GNAT is a compiler for the Ada programming language. It produces optimized code on platforms supported by the GNU Compiler Collection (GCC).

libgmsh4.11

Three-dimensional finite element mesh generator shared library

Gmsh is a 3D finite element grid generator with a build-in CAD engine and post-processor. Its design goal is to provide a fast, light and user-friendly meshing tool with parametric input and advanced visualization capabilities. Gmsh is built around four modules: geometry, mesh, solver and post-processing. The specification of any input to these modules is done either interactively using the graphical user interface or in ASCII text files using Gmsh's own scripting language.

go-cowsql

Pure-Go cowsql client

Go-cowsql is a pure-Go cowsql client implementation. 2 binaries are provided: - cowsql-demo, a demo cowsql application, which exposes a simple key/value store over an HTTP API, - cowsql, a basic SQLite-like cowsql shell which supports normal SQL queries plus the special .cluster and .leader commands to inspect the cluster members and the current leader.
